Description | How do wild animals survive winter's cold? Meet live creatures that usually spend the winter in sheltered places, like deep in the soil, in rotten logs, or under water. Then help plastic and plush bugs, birds, mammals and reptiles find safe places to spend the winter in the Great Outdoors exhibit. You can also touch real mammal tracks at the play dough table. |
